THE GRACE I SEEK: The grace of slowly surrendering myself to the loving mercy of God and responding to the invitation to love.
READ: Luke 12:32-34 "Your heart will always be where your treasure is."
My little group of disciples, don't be afraid! Your Father wants to give you the kingdom. Sell what you have and give the money to the poor. Make yourselves moneybags that never wear out. Make sure your treasure is safe in heaven, where thieves cannot steal it and moths cannot destroy it. Your heart will always be where your treasure is.
REFLECTION: The Invitation of Love — Please Be with Me
We will ponder the power of the invitation of love from someone we love. What impact would it have on me?
We will compare this invitation to the one we receive from our Lord and God.
Over the past several weeks, it has been the delight I’ve longed for — to show you how much I love you. How I have wanted you to know how much I have desired to free your heart. And now that you have asked me what you can do — what return you could make for such love — I feel eager to invite you to be with me.
Please be with me in my mission. “Because God has chosen me to tell the good news to the poor, to announce freedom for prisoners, to give sight to the blind, to free everyone who suffers.”
And I need you. I need your support and your free heart. It won’t always be easy. But we will be together every time you are with me in loving. If you are with me in the struggle of love, we will grow together in love in ways I can ask you only to imagine. If you are with me in the dying to self-love that is our mission, then you will be with me in the fullness of life, forever. God’s reign is at hand. Together we can bring it closer. Please be with me.
Just consider this invitation. Feel it. It isn’t imaginary. It is very real. How special we are to receive such an invitation of love!
